There are several types of oil seals that Honda vehicles may require, varying in size, shape, and material. Understanding which oil seal to use is crucial for optimal performance.
Type | Description | Common Applications |
---|---|---|
Double Lip Oil Seal | Has two sealing lips to provide an extra layer of protection against leaks. | Engine crankshafts and camshafts. |
Single Lip Oil Seal | Features a single sealing lip, used for applications requiring less resistance. | Transmission gear shafts. |
Spring-loaded Oil Seal | Incorporates a spring to maintain constant pressure against the shaft. | High-speed applications. |
Honda oil seals are typically made from materials such as rubber, polyurethane, or composite materials. The choice of material significantly impacts their durability and performance.
